Output 95cc90e59b078c712eeb3d0116ce5ccdeaff6f203f939847e088629208d88f68:1

value
35159
script pubkey
OP_0 OP_PUSHBYTES_20 720742fab4258e171fac15a425a10e9736e13ed7
address
tb1qwgr59745yk8pw8avzkjztggwjumwz0khe0lksz
transaction
95cc90e59b078c712eeb3d0116ce5ccdeaff6f203f939847e088629208d88f68
confirmations
69908
spent
true